Commit Graph

  • 7a9a9b7d76 ip: add OpenBSD support Ali H. Fardan 2018-04-29 10:55:38 +03:00
  • 97ef7c2a1d Remove non-portable functions from config.def.h Aaron Marcher 2018-04-16 19:09:07 +02:00
  • 8601c27264 Add Darron Anderson to LICENSE Aaron Marcher 2018-04-14 19:44:54 +02:00
  • c2e7d6812c Remove ram_*() from README Aaron Marcher 2018-04-14 19:44:25 +02:00
  • 88bf05e4a3 Add OpenBSD RAM stats Darron Anderson 2018-04-14 09:41:35 +00:00
  • faa52bdcc0 Format error messages properly Aaron Marcher 2018-03-28 19:46:27 +02:00
  • 2289798b6d Remove program name from error messages Aaron Marcher 2018-03-28 18:49:27 +02:00
  • 96f3a8a54e Get rid of err.h as it is not portable Aaron Marcher 2018-03-28 18:26:56 +02:00
  • aced832622 Remove unnecessary headers Aaron Marcher 2018-03-28 18:14:08 +02:00
  • 198df15d83 Remove ALSA dependency from README Aaron Marcher 2018-03-26 18:09:30 +02:00
  • e79d4932ea More robust preprocessor switches Aaron Marcher 2018-03-21 12:21:37 +01:00
  • fc5d23212f uptime: Port to OpenBSD. Aaron Marcher 2018-03-20 00:48:10 +01:00
  • 7e3f80c1a3 battery_perc: Port to OpenBSD. Aaron Marcher 2018-03-19 18:44:52 +01:00
  • ad5b7c8b1c README: Add list of non-portable functions Aaron Marcher 2018-03-18 23:30:54 +01:00
  • ebf5a35052 Build Linux-only functions only on Linux Aaron Marcher 2018-03-18 23:26:13 +01:00
  • 25bda72e64 README: Add Todo Aaron Marcher 2018-03-18 22:51:51 +01:00
  • ff65c4a413 Merge pull request #43 from SiIky/unknown_str Aaron Marcher 2018-02-17 20:00:04 +00:00
  • 9ca1ac62f9 Print unknown_str in case of error SiIky 2018-02-17 18:08:27 +00:00
  • 8bfe4b2e28 Update LICENSE year for myself. Aaron Marcher 2018-01-06 23:40:05 +01:00
  • fa62e8199e Fix a bug in wifi_essid(). Aaron Marcher 2018-01-06 23:37:09 +01:00
  • 47d0073bfd Small fixes in config.mk Aaron Marcher 2017-12-03 01:40:38 +01:00
  • 52d60c0862 Update LICENSE for parazyd Aaron Marcher 2017-10-24 11:23:27 +02:00
  • d2988c72e3 Return actual percentage for wifi_perc() parazyd 2017-10-24 11:03:17 +02:00
  • 7246dc4381 Move components into dedicated subdirectory Laslo Hunhold 2017-09-24 15:33:01 +02:00
  • 61e44e8948 Get rid of HDR variable Laslo Hunhold 2017-09-18 08:53:19 +02:00
  • f56e50a269 Simplify Makefile Laslo Hunhold 2017-09-17 23:48:11 +02:00
  • e04a385364 Fix missing config.h in Makefile Quentin Rameau 2017-09-17 22:31:26 +02:00
  • 11d4bec648 Added LICENSE statements to all source files Aaron Marcher 2017-09-17 17:45:03 +02:00
  • 914440b4fc Properly declare buf as extern and fix all unused-warnings Laslo Hunhold 2017-09-17 17:21:54 +02:00
  • eea99fc0ac Rewrite Makefile to accomodate file split Laslo Hunhold 2017-09-17 17:12:44 +02:00
  • 6820631175 Split into multiple files Aaron Marcher 2017-09-17 16:18:17 +02:00
  • 8e25af7dc3 Add blank line after setlocale Aaron Marcher 2017-09-16 14:11:49 +02:00
  • fb1f1dea2e slstatus: set locale Kurt Van Dijck 2017-09-11 20:05:21 +02:00
  • 53e0c4535a Added CPU iowait to README Aaron Marcher 2017-09-16 13:54:28 +02:00
  • 72a5e52a35 slstatus: add cpu_iowait Kurt Van Dijck 2017-09-14 23:58:38 +02:00
  • 57aa6a5164 Deleted slstatus.png as it is unnecessary Aaron Marcher 2017-09-14 22:20:44 +02:00
  • b7d7ce9c5f slstatus load_avg format string Kamil Cholewiński 2017-09-08 23:08:28 +02:00
  • 8f5219b6da Added IPv6 address function Aaron Marcher 2017-08-14 18:00:46 +02:00
  • fcc5c683a6 sexy config.def.h table Aaron Marcher 2017-08-14 14:04:21 +02:00
  • 0f7e022381 Fix a little logic error Laslo Hunhold 2017-08-14 10:24:43 +02:00
  • e1e1b1d79a Add pscanf() Laslo Hunhold 2017-08-14 00:34:00 +02:00
  • 796b661284 Refactor main() Laslo Hunhold 2017-08-13 23:21:23 +02:00
  • 3468a6e368 Simplify signal handling a bit Laslo Hunhold 2017-08-13 20:33:44 +02:00
  • 450e8e6e6b Remove unnecessary prototypes Laslo Hunhold 2017-08-13 20:21:49 +02:00
  • ecf2779904 Remove unnecessary blank lines after license-notice Laslo Hunhold 2017-08-13 20:21:04 +02:00
  • 6a33d6c875 Fix man page .Os field Aaron Marcher 2017-08-13 23:25:44 +02:00
  • aa17443013 Added Makefile target for distribution tarballs. Aaron Marcher 2017-08-13 23:05:22 +02:00
  • 96334e2079 Fixed man page path Aaron Marcher 2017-08-13 22:56:14 +02:00
  • 779f611208 slstatus != dmenu lol Aaron Marcher 2017-08-12 13:37:12 +02:00
  • c4779c9b15 Removed #define for unknown_str Aaron Marcher 2017-08-12 13:27:30 +02:00
  • be12b6b350 Removed #define for update interval Aaron Marcher 2017-08-12 13:06:24 +02:00
  • 0c2ee7df91 Updated LICENSE Aaron Marcher 2017-08-12 12:55:53 +02:00
  • 2c114ec2b5 keyboard_indicators: fix segfault when -s is specified Ali H. Fardan 2017-08-12 07:01:13 +03:00
  • 6f01174392 Fixed possible NULL-deref and removed unnecessary XOpenDisplay() Aaron Marcher 2017-08-11 14:33:02 +02:00
  • 1814061396 Add and use LEN() macro Laslo Hunhold 2017-08-11 13:39:19 +02:00
  • 178c23e3d2 Refactor battery_state() Laslo Hunhold 2017-08-11 00:17:49 +02:00
  • 6b8384ef2f Reformatted LICENSE to fit 75 character width Aaron Marcher 2017-08-10 22:43:56 +02:00
  • 00ce7a746a Print usage() when we are left with arguments Laslo Hunhold 2017-08-10 22:23:55 +02:00
  • c9d47405f4 Reduce -o | -n to -s Laslo Hunhold 2017-08-10 22:22:39 +02:00
  • 4d33c36014 Remove d- and v-flags Laslo Hunhold 2017-08-10 21:56:06 +02:00
  • 958c34052a Convert slstatus.1 to mandoc, simplify it and remove -h Laslo Hunhold 2017-08-10 21:36:29 +02:00
  • 8dad4910bf Refactor build system Laslo Hunhold 2017-08-10 21:32:10 +02:00
  • d35e518e39 New README in plain text Aaron Marcher 2017-08-10 21:49:37 +02:00
  • b6fb77c7ac Removed TODO.md Aaron Marcher 2017-08-10 21:10:17 +02:00
  • 5134a480b5 Removed CONTRIBUTING.md Aaron Marcher 2017-08-10 21:08:53 +02:00
  • b3eed601e5 Moved contributors to LICENSE Aaron Marcher 2017-08-10 21:06:48 +02:00
  • dad6dc6300 Copyright sign (C) is not required in LICENSE Aaron Marcher 2017-08-10 20:32:14 +02:00
  • be4cffef39 Removed .gitignore from repository Aaron Marcher 2017-08-10 20:30:52 +02:00
  • 999cf00490 new arg.h version by frign Aaron Marcher 2017-08-10 11:31:57 +02:00
  • 4b4b2ac079 add num_files() function for maildirs ;) aaron marcher 2017-08-06 15:02:16 +02:00
  • ad39aa012c updated readme Aaron Marcher 2017-06-13 00:11:35 +02:00
  • 1c8aa5318f check for fgets/fscanf return values Aaron Marcher 2017-06-13 00:06:56 +02:00
  • 597cdc6b5c use a static buffer instead of dynamic memory Aaron Marcher 2017-06-13 00:06:04 +02:00
  • abbaa7af44 remove format characters from stat functions Aaron Marcher 2017-06-12 23:59:21 +02:00
  • 832b21ca4b add cpu_freq function Aaron Marcher 2017-06-12 23:56:21 +02:00
  • 259e967cbf add battery_power function Aaron Marcher 2017-06-12 23:55:27 +02:00
  • 870d68d44e added option to output only once and exit afterwards Aaron Marcher 2017-05-11 19:06:45 +02:00
  • ac1a57ec30 enable stack protector and compile to position independent executable Aaron Marcher 2017-04-20 22:33:10 +02:00
  • d144c8de3d simplified and improved vol_perc() Aaron Marcher 2017-04-20 22:30:04 +02:00
  • c288663ebd fix overflow in run_command() Aaron Marcher 2017-04-20 22:20:19 +02:00
  • b2714032e5 username(): get rid of unneeded uid variable Aaron Marcher 2017-04-20 22:18:24 +02:00
  • 95ceafcae7 Merge pull request #39 from stoeckmann/fgets Aaron Marcher 2017-04-20 22:14:56 +02:00
  • 35295f1902 On success, fgets always terminates the result. Tobias Stoeckmann 2017-04-04 21:27:31 +02:00
  • 1289bdb742 Merge pull request #38 from stoeckmann/terminating-nul Aaron Marcher 2017-04-02 15:27:09 +02:00
  • b1e7c40b21 Fixed out of boundary write on long lines. Tobias Stoeckmann 2017-04-02 13:12:03 +02:00
  • cceeec0efa loading thresholds state Aaron Marcher 2017-03-30 17:32:20 +02:00
  • b11dd2db0e Fixed XCloseDisplay() which is not reached in keyboard_indicators() Aaron Marcher 2017-01-23 21:01:41 +01:00
  • 823f2d047f Added keyboard_indicators (Fixes #31) Aaron Marcher 2017-01-16 12:10:56 +01:00
  • 3f976aabc0 Makefile fix and vol_perc fix for mute Aaron Marcher 2017-01-09 12:05:29 +01:00
  • a3cb24c438 simplified Makefile Aaron Marcher 2017-01-09 09:29:58 +01:00
  • 09c3ffe33b small Makefile tweak Aaron Marcher 2017-01-09 09:23:17 +01:00
  • bb87736518 Makefile: Added back config.h handling in Makefile Aaron Marcher 2017-01-09 09:21:18 +01:00
  • 98d655c8d0 Makefile: Fixes #35 Aaron Marcher 2017-01-09 08:24:26 +01:00
  • 99bc258586 todo Aaron Marcher 2017-01-07 22:34:45 +01:00
  • 0d1f19d777 removed ./extern/ Aaron Marcher 2017-01-07 22:33:28 +01:00
  • 688e2e783d removed strlcat dependency (was used only once) Aaron Marcher 2017-01-07 22:31:46 +01:00
  • 32bb92453a got rid of concat.h Aaron Marcher 2017-01-07 22:01:49 +01:00
  • d1915f0d4d saner makefile: cleaner, simpler, suckless Aaron Marcher 2017-01-07 21:49:10 +01:00
  • 3847911771 happy new year! Aaron Marcher 2017-01-07 21:28:22 +01:00
  • 8a29374783 run_command: strlen() will not function if string is not null terminated Aaron Marcher 2017-01-07 21:19:40 +01:00